New prostate surgery aims to cut incontinence by saving the urethra
Disease control
Recruiting now
This study tests a new robot-assisted surgery for localized prostate cancer that leaves the full length of the urethra intact. The goal is to help men regain urinary continence faster after prostate removal. About 60 men with early-stage prostate cancer will undergo the procedure…
